I've Always Loved Summer Best, or August
When I was born to celebrate my father actually bought a duplex beach house with his college roommate Solly Stein in Woodmont, Connecticut on the Jewish beach rocky Long Island sound Italians next door their beach was sand we weren't a beachy family my mother did have sun dresses library books big straw hat my father went into the water every single night after work breast stroke and crawl my brother was the only one who got a real dark tan I was happier there than anywhere best friend Abby Glazer few doors down we would wander in a way i hadn't wandered before didn't need much she was a very good swimmer I was OK not great I would carry a little notebook make up stories about her swimming about our neighbor Joanie Mendleson I would find husbands for Joanie in so many stories. At night I'd sit on the sea wall in front of our house and know Tomorrow I could do it all again.
